Explore les preuves formelles, les problèmes de satisfaisabilité et les invariants inductifs en utilisant des requêtes SAT dans des circuits séquentiels.
Explore la programmation dynamique du problème Knapsack, en discutant des stratégies, des algorithmes, de la dureté du NP et de l'analyse de la complexité temporelle.
Explore l'inférence causale, les graphiques dirigés et l'équité dans les algorithmes, en mettant l'accent sur l'indépendance conditionnelle et les implications des GAD.